Historical Evolution and Development
Jiangsu’s textile heritage dates back centuries, rooted in the rich cultural history of the Yangtze River Delta. Initially known for silk production and handwoven fabrics, the region gradually industrialized during the 20th century, embracing mechanization and mass production. In recent decades, government policies and private investments have propelled Jiangsu to the forefront of textile innovation. The establishment of specialized industrial parks and research institutions has fostered a culture of continuous improvement, enabling the industry to adapt to changing global demands. Today, Jiangsu’s textile sector benefits from a well-developed infrastructure, including advanced logistics networks and ports that facilitate international trade.
Key Strengths and Product Diversity
One of the defining features of the Jiangsu textile industry is its diverse product portfolio. From high-quality cotton and silk to synthetic fibers and technical textiles, the region caters to a wide array of markets. Apparel fabrics, home textiles, and industrial materials are among the key outputs, with a focus on durability, comfort, and aesthetic appeal. Jiangsu’s manufacturers excel in producing customized solutions, such as moisture-wicking activewear, flame-retardant fabrics for safety applications, and eco-friendly materials for sustainable fashion. The integration of digital printing and smart textiles further enhances product versatility, meeting the needs of consumers and businesses alike.
Innovation and Technological Advancements
Innovation is at the heart of Jiangsu’s textile success. The industry leverages advanced technologies like artificial intelligence, automation, and the Internet of Things (IoT) to optimize production processes. For instance, smart factories in Jiangsu utilize real-time data analytics to monitor quality control and reduce waste. Research and development centers collaborate with universities and international partners to pioneer new materials, such as biodegradable fibers and nanotextiles. These efforts not only improve efficiency but also position Jiangsu as a hub for textile R&D, attracting global talent and investment.
Sustainability and Environmental Practices
In response to growing environmental concerns, the Jiangsu textile industry has embraced sustainable practices. Many manufacturers adhere to strict regulations on water and energy consumption, implementing closed-loop systems that recycle resources. Eco-friendly dyeing techniques and the use of organic raw materials minimize the ecological footprint. Certifications like GOTS (Global Organic Textile Standard) and OEKO-TEX are common, ensuring products meet international safety and sustainability criteria. Additionally, initiatives for circular economy models, such as textile recycling and upcycling, demonstrate Jiangsu’s commitment to long-term environmental stewardship.
Global Influence and Market Reach
Jiangsu’s textiles are exported to over 100 countries, contributing significantly to the global supply chain. The region’s strategic location near major ports like Shanghai and Nanjing enables efficient logistics, reducing lead times for international clients. Trade fairs and exhibitions in cities such as Suzhou and Wuxi showcase the latest trends, fostering partnerships with brands worldwide. By maintaining high standards of quality and compliance with international regulations, Jiangsu has built a reputation for reliability and innovation, making it a preferred sourcing destination for fashion, automotive, and healthcare industries.
Challenges and Future Prospects
Despite its strengths, the Jiangsu textile industry faces challenges such as rising labor costs, global competition, and the need for continuous innovation. However, these are being addressed through digital transformation and workforce upskilling. Looking ahead, the industry is poised to capitalize on trends like smart textiles, personalized manufacturing, and green technology. Government support for digitalization and sustainable development will further enhance competitiveness. By focusing on high-value products and global collaboration, Jiangsu is set to maintain its leadership role in the evolving textile landscape.
